THE STORY
National Ghost Hunting Day has become a significant day for those intrigued by the paranormal. Established in 2016 by the American Ghost Adventures, this day encourages individuals to explore the unexplained and share their findings. The event unites ghost hunting enthusiasts and curious newcomers, fostering a community passionate about the supernatural.
The last Saturday in September is more than just a day; it is a celebration of the eerie and the unknown. Ghost hunting events are held across the country, with many locations offering special tours on this day. From haunted hotels in Savannah, Georgia, to the infamous Winchester Mystery House in California, the opportunities for exploration are extensive.
As participants venture into the night, they often carry tools like EMF detectors, spirit boxes, and cameras, hoping to capture evidence of the supernatural. The thrill of potentially encountering a ghost adds to the excitement, making every investigation a unique experience. Many enthusiasts enjoy sharing their stories on social media, creating a lively discourse around ghost hunting.
In addition to individual explorations, National Ghost Hunting Day serves as a reminder of the rich folklore and history that surrounds many haunted sites. From the spirits of the past to urban legends, the stories that emerge often reflect cultural anxieties and historical events. Whether a skeptic or a believer, this day invites everyone to delve into the mysteries of the afterlife.

Haunted Locations
Explore famous haunted sites like the Stanley Hotel in Colorado or the Myrtles Plantation in Louisiana. Each location has its own unique tales of spirits and paranormal activity.
Ghost Hunting Gear
Essential equipment for ghost hunters includes EMF detectors, infrared cameras, and audio recorders. Knowing how to use these tools can enhance your ghost hunting experience.
Ghost Stories
Gather around and share chilling ghost stories. Whether personal experiences or local legends, storytelling is a key part of ghost hunting culture.
Nighttime Adventures
Ghost hunting is best experienced at night. The darkness adds an element of suspense, making every sound and shadow feel more pronounced.
